How do I remove the rear brake lines? I attempted to disconnect the solid line from the flexible one on my rear end because I'm doing a drum to disc conversion, but I ended up rounding off two corners of the 10mm bolt on the hard line.

How do you guys manage to get those off? I tried lots and lots of PB Blaster by the way, but it didn't help.
